虚拟机如何过dnf检测

虚拟机如何过dnf检测

虚拟机过DNF检测的核心观点使用隐藏虚拟机技术、改动虚拟机配置、伪装硬件信息、使用反检测工具。其中,使用隐藏虚拟机技术是最重要的一点。通过隐藏虚拟机技术,可以掩盖虚拟机的运行环境,使得检测系统无法识别虚拟机的存在,从而绕过检测。

虚拟机(Virtual Machine, VM)是一种在计算机系统中创建的虚拟化环境,允许用户在一台物理计算机上运行多个操作系统。对于一些游戏和应用程序,如DNF(Dungeon & Fighter),为了防止作弊和滥用,开发者通常会加入虚拟机检测机制。因此,如何绕过这些检测机制成为了一个技术难题。本文将详细介绍如何通过多种技术手段,使虚拟机成功绕过DNF的检测。

一、使用隐藏虚拟机技术

隐藏虚拟机技术是指通过修改虚拟机的配置和运行环境,掩盖其虚拟化特征,使得检测系统无法识别虚拟机的存在。

修改虚拟机配置文件

虚拟机配置文件通常包含虚拟机的硬件配置和相关信息。通过修改这些配置文件,可以隐藏虚拟机的特征。例如,可以修改VMware虚拟机的.vmx文件,将其中的特定参数值改为物理机的值。

monitor_control.restrict_backdoor = "true"

monitor_control.disable_directexec = "true"

monitor_control.disable_chksimd = "true"

使用虚拟机隐藏补丁

一些第三方工具和补丁可以帮助隐藏虚拟机的特征,例如NoMachine、VMware Tools等。这些工具通过修改虚拟机的底层代码和驱动程序,掩盖其虚拟化特征。

二、改动虚拟机配置

通过改动虚拟机的配置,可以减少虚拟机被检测到的风险。

修改虚拟硬件配置

虚拟机的硬件配置通常具有一定的规律性,例如虚拟CPU、虚拟网卡等。通过修改这些配置,使其更接近物理机,可以减少被检测的概率。例如,可以使用物理机的网卡MAC地址替换虚拟机的MAC地址。

隐藏虚拟机进程

虚拟机运行时,会产生一些特定的进程,例如vmware-vmx.exe。通过修改这些进程的名称或隐藏这些进程,可以减少被检测的风险。

三、伪装硬件信息

伪装硬件信息是通过修改虚拟机的硬件特征,使其与物理机相似,从而绕过检测。

修改硬件序列号

硬件序列号是检测虚拟机的一种重要手段。通过修改虚拟机的硬件序列号,使其与物理机的序列号一致,可以绕过检测。例如,可以使用DMIEdit工具修改BIOS序列号。

修改硬件设备信息

虚拟机的硬件设备信息通常具有一定的规律性,例如虚拟硬盘、虚拟光驱等。通过修改这些设备信息,使其更接近物理机,可以减少被检测的概率。例如,可以使用Device Guard工具修改设备信息。

四、使用反检测工具

反检测工具是一些专门用于绕过虚拟机检测的软件和脚本,通过各种技术手段,掩盖虚拟机的特征。

使用Vmware Hardened Loader

Vmware Hardened Loader是一种专门用于隐藏Vmware虚拟机的软件工具。它通过修改虚拟机的底层代码和配置文件,掩盖其虚拟化特征,使得检测系统无法识别虚拟机的存在。

使用Sandboxie

Sandboxie是一种沙盒技术,可以在虚拟机内部创建一个隔离的运行环境,通过这种技术,可以减少虚拟机被检测的概率。

五、实际操作步骤

在具体操作中,可以综合使用以上几种技术,具体步骤如下:

安装虚拟机

首先,安装虚拟机软件,例如Vmware Workstation或VirtualBox。

修改虚拟机配置

安装虚拟机后,修改虚拟机的配置文件,隐藏其虚拟化特征。

使用反检测工具

安装并配置反检测工具,例如Vmware Hardened Loader或Sandboxie。

伪装硬件信息

使用DMIEdit等工具,修改虚拟机的硬件信息,使其与物理机一致。

测试虚拟机

完成以上步骤后,启动虚拟机并测试其是否能够绕过DNF的检测。如果检测失败,可以尝试调整虚拟机配置或更换反检测工具。

六、常见问题及解决方案

在实际操作中,可能会遇到一些常见问题,以下是一些解决方案:

虚拟机无法启动

如果虚拟机无法启动,可能是配置文件修改不当导致的。可以尝试恢复原始配置文件或重新安装虚拟机。

虚拟机被检测到

如果虚拟机被检测到,可以尝试使用不同的反检测工具或修改虚拟机的硬件信息。

游戏运行不稳定

如果游戏在虚拟机中运行不稳定,可以尝试调整虚拟机的硬件配置或更换虚拟机软件。

七、总结

通过综合使用隐藏虚拟机技术、改动虚拟机配置、伪装硬件信息和反检测工具,可以有效地绕过DNF的虚拟机检测。然而,这些技术手段需要一定的技术基础和实践经验。在实际操作中,可能会遇到各种问题,需要不断调整和优化配置。

需要注意的是,绕过虚拟机检测可能违反游戏的使用条款,可能导致账号被封禁等后果。因此,用户在进行相关操作时,应充分了解相关风险,并自行承担责任。

通过以上步骤和技术手段,用户可以在虚拟机中成功运行DNF,并在虚拟环境中体验游戏。然而,这些技术手段不仅仅适用于DNF,还可以应用于其他需要绕过虚拟机检测的应用程序和游戏。希望本文能够为读者提供有价值的参考和指导。

相关问答FAQs:

Q: 虚拟机如何通过DNF检测?

A: 通过以下步骤,您可以使虚拟机通过DNF检测,确保您的游戏账号安全:

  1. 为什么虚拟机会被DNF检测? 虚拟机被认为是一种可能用于作弊的工具,DNF检测系统会识别虚拟机并禁止其运行游戏。

  2. 如何绕过DNF检测? 首先,确保您使用的是最新版本的虚拟机软件,因为DNF检测系统会不断升级以识别新的虚拟机。其次,尽量避免在虚拟机中运行其他可能被检测到的作弊软件。最后,可以尝试使用一些虚拟机逃避工具,但请注意这可能违反游戏规定,导致账号被封。

  3. 如何确保虚拟机能够通过DNF检测? 首先,关闭虚拟机中的所有作弊软件或插件。其次,确保虚拟机的硬件配置与您实际使用的计算机相似,包括处理器型号、显卡型号等。最后,避免频繁切换虚拟机与实际机器之间的操作,以免被检测到异常行为。

请注意,虽然绕过DNF检测可能是一种诱惑,但这违反了游戏规定,并可能导致封禁账号。我们建议您遵守游戏规则,以保护自己的账号安全。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2761189

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部